Here is what I like going down the stretch in the recruiting battle to keep Andrew Parker against Auburn. They don't have any players on their current roster or in their recruiting class from Louisiana. We have 11 returning, Texas has 5 returning, and Texas A&M has 7 returning from Louisiana. So, we have a pretty comfortable familiar Louisiana culture on our team along a couple others that visited with him that could signing. A&M doesn't have any current Louisiana players in their class and Texas has 1. So, I would say we definitely have more of the home away from home feel in our locker room among the finalist.
